Delicious food (cod loin is beautiful) but on the expensive side if you are a bigger eater. Sticking to the veggie and fish dishes is more economical than the meat dishes, which is what we did. Some of the meat tapas were over £15 per dish. The Rioja wine that has purples in the label with initials VC was lovely and has an average cost of £30 per bottle. Overall, it was a nice experience. Decor, waiting staff, and ambience are great. I would recommend a visit if you've not been before, but it's not for someone who is looking for exceptional value for money.
